Choose Model-Fingerprint if…

  • Model-Fingerprint is primarily Python; llm-leaderboard is JavaScript.
  • License: Model-Fingerprint is MIT, llm-leaderboard is Other.
  • Tags unique to Model-Fingerprint: fingerprinting, large language models, pytorch.
  • Use Model-Fingerprint when you need to fingerprint large language models for evaluation or observability purposes, especially in research contexts involving CUDA 11.3 and PyTorch 2.0 environments.

When NOT to use Model-Fingerprint

  • Do not use Model-Fingerprint if your development environment does not support CUDA 11.3 and PyTorch 2.0, as it may lead to incompatibility issues.
  • Avoid this toolset if you need a solution that supports multiple versions of CUDA or Pytorch for flexibility across different hardware configurations without modification.

Choose llm-leaderboard if…

  • llm-leaderboard is primarily JavaScript; Model-Fingerprint is Python.
  • License: llm-leaderboard is Other, Model-Fingerprint is MIT.
  • Tags unique to llm-leaderboard: llm, llm-agents, llm-evaluation, llmops.
  • Also covers LLM Frameworks.
  • When you need to compare historical performance and service costs of different LLMs within the constraints of outdated data.

When NOT to use llm-leaderboard

  • If timely or updated benchmarking data is a requirement, as llm-leaderboard's repository has been deprecated.
  • For real-time evaluations, as this tool does not provide current or recent performance metrics and pricing details.
